ALUVA: Hindu youth who married Muslim lover, got thrashed by her relatives demanding to change his religion. The victim, 27-year-old Abhinand and his 48-year-old-mother Lekha, wife of Murugan from Pallathu in Thoppumpadi were admitted to Aluva Karottukuzhi hospital with serious injuries.
The incident happened by 7 pm on Friday evening. The relatives of his wife demanded he should either accept Islam or sign the divorce papers. The couples had got married three years ago as per Hindu customs. Both of them got involved in the relationship when they were working in a private firm at Perumbavoor. Later after registering their marriage, they also got married as per Hindu customs at Elamakkara temple. The girl stayed with Abhijith for about one and a half year. In between this, the girl’s relatives made attempts to take her back several times but they were not successful. Another incident also happened in which the girl tried to escape from the custody of her relatives in Malappuram.
The girl who was taken back by her relatives to Malappuram about one and a health years ago was continuing her relationship with her husband via phone. A group of 11 people including the girl’s mother and sister reached Abhijith’s home when the purported incident took place. As it was a friendly talk, Abhijith’s mother Lekha, called her son via phone and summoned him. Lekha said that on Abhijith entering home, the girl’s uncle, Ijaz attacked him. In the skirmish that ensued, Lekha fell down and broke her right hand. Aluva police which reached the site following the skirmish took Ijaz under custody.
